Job description
Overview

Join our team as a Mobile Technician and be at the forefront of driving innovative solutions that create a more sustainable future for all. This exciting role offers diverse opportunities across a comprehensive range of mechanical and electrical work, including commercial/industrial wiring, PAT testing, fixed wire testing, system controls, and HVAC systems, as well as pipework and welding. We are particularly interested in candidates with electrical experience, though we welcome applicants from other trades and are committed to providing training and development opportunities to help you expand your expertise across multiple disciplines. Responsibilities
  • Carry out work as per schedule supplied by the Contracts Manager or Supervisor.
  • Complete site documentation before and after work tasks.
  • Liaise with subcontractors during planned service maintenance.
  • All work on site to be carried out in accordance with site EHS (Environmental Health and Safety) and Veolia EHS rules and guidelines.
  • Flexibility to work on equipment in all buildings and around Maintenance Shutdowns
  • Participate in Audits of the Mechanical and Electrical plant rooms and follow up on actions.
  • Be part of an Industrial Energy team that manages the maintenance of industrial FM Services as well as steam and LTHW systems including District Heating and HIU servicing (Residential), Combined Heat and Power Plants and Heat Pump systems.
  • Carry out routine and statutory planned preventative maintenance (PPM), reactive and breakdown works to all mechanical and electrical systems across all the sites.
  • Ensure that the Steam & Hot water boilers are maintained as per OEM specifications.
  • Ensure that Heat Pumps are maintained as per OEM specifications.
  • Ensure that plant faults and defects are swiftly rectified to maintain the plants in serviceable order at all times (24/7).
  • Maintenance and publication of plant quality records and reports.
  • Carry out daily routine operational tasks to plants that will comply with legislation and company policies.
  • Participate in an on-call rota, providing out-of-hours cover, along with weekend working.
  • This role involves some lifting, working at heights and/or in confined spaces.
  • Experience with Pumps, HVAC Systems, Compressors, Boilers, steam systems and ancillary services (DHW skids), Chillers, Cooling Towers, Clean steam Boilers, Purified Water Systems, CIP systems; general canteen/kitchen equipment.

Desirable qualifications
  • Demonstrate hands‑on experience of troubleshooting and repair of commercial and industrial electrical systems; and related mechanical experience.
  • Electrical experience - City & Guilds 2382 – 18th Edition
  • City & Guilds 2391
  • FGas‑OPD Reg Certification
  • High Voltage Operational Safety Certificate
  • Boiler Operations Accreditation Scheme (BOAS)
  • Medium Risk Confined Space
  • Health and safety qualifications and awareness, risk assessment, method statement training, competence in issuing and use of all company Permit to Work systems would be preferential, however training will be provided where appropriate.
